    Converting 10 feet to inches is a straightforward process that requires basic arithmetic skills. There are 12 inches in one foot, so to convert 10 feet to inches, you simply multiply 10 by 12. This calculation yields 120 inches, which is the equivalent of 10 feet in inches.
